Besides being trained in Spanish Classical Dance and Modern Dance, Natalia studied flamenco in Madrid with La China, La Tacha, Concha Jareño, Manuel Liñan, Belén Maya and Rafaela Carrasco, and with Manolo Marin, Isabel Bayon, and Adela Campallo in Sevilla. She has performed in tablaos “El Andalus” and “El Corral de la Morería,” in Madrid, and at “El Flamenco” Tablao in Tokyo. From 2007 to present she danced with the Compañia de Antonio el Pipa, Jerez de la Frontera. She has taught bata de cola and manton workshops internationally.
